Understanding the Format of Knoxnews Obituaries

Obituaries on Knoxnews follow a pretty standard format, but there are a few nuances worth noting.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ect:

  • Name: The full name of the deceased, including any nicknames.
  • Date of Birth & Death: These are usually listed prominently.
  • Family Details: Information about surviving family members, including spouses, children, and siblings.
  • Biography: A short summary of the person’s life, including notable achievements and interests.
  • Memorial Information: Details about funeral services or memorial events.

Some entries might also include additional details like favorite quotes, hobbies, or even links to charitable organizations in the person’s name. It’s all about creating a comprehensive picture of the individual.

Tips for Writing a Meaningful Obituary

If you’re tasked with writing an obituary for a loved one, here are a few tips to help you create something truly meaningful:

  • Start with the basics: name, birth date, and date of passing.
  • Include personal details like family members, hobbies, and achievements.
  • Keep it concise but heartfelt—focus on what made the person unique.
  • Consider adding a favorite quote or memory to make it more personal.

Remember, an obituary isn’t just about listing facts—it’s about telling a story. Take your time and put thought into every word.
